‘Superhero’ Kohli smashes IPL runs record

Red-hot Virat Kohli smashed an unbeaten half-century to break Chris Gayle’s record for the most runs in a single Indian Premier League season.

Kohli, captain of the Royal Challengers Bangalore, has racked up 752 runs in 12 matches so far this year including three centuries and five 50s.


Kohli’s 75-run blitz on Monday kept the Challengers’ play-off hopes alive after they crushed the Kolkata Knight Riders by nine wickets.

The Indian batsman overtakes the powerful Gayle, who scored 733 runs in 15 matches in 2012, while Australia’s Mike Hussey tallied the same figure in 17 games in 2013.

Kohli, who batted with an injured finger, stitched together a 115-run unbeaten stand with AB de Villiers (59).

Their partnership comes just two days after they recorded the highest partnership (229) in Twenty20 cricket history during the Challengers’ match against the Gujarat Lions.

Team-mate Gayle, who also found form at Eden Gardens with a 31-ball 49, paid credit to the in-form duo.

“Those two guys are playing like Batman and Superman. They are in the form of their life,” said the Jamaican.

Wimbledon draw: Alcaraz opens against Fognini, Sabalenka faces qualifier

CARLOS ALCARAZ will begin his attempt to win a third straight Wimbledon title against Italian Fabio Fognini, while women’s top seed Aryna Sabalenka opens her campaign against Canadian qualifier Carson Branstine.

The draw, held on Friday at the All England Club, featured several notable first-round matchups.

Jofra Archer recalled for second Test against India

JOFRA ARCHER has been named in England's squad for the second Test against India, marking his return to the Test side after more than four years.

The 30-year-old fast bowler has struggled with injuries throughout his career and has played just 13 Tests, the last of which was in February 2021.

Rajasthan Royals owner accuses former partner of blackmail

INDIAN PREMIER LEAGUE cricket franchise Rajasthan Royals' majority owner has accused his former co-owner of trying to blackmail him by alleging he was defrauded out of his minority stake in the club.

London-based venture capitalist Manoj Badale and his company Emerging Media Ventures are suing businessman Raj Kundra at London's High Court for allegedly breaching a 2019 confidential settlement agreement.

Alcaraz hits form ahead of Wimbledon

CARLOS ALCARAZ warned his Wimbledon rivals that he “feels great” on grass after the world number two defied his own expectations by winning the Queen’s Club title for a second time.

Alcaraz battled to a bruising 7-5, 6-7 (5/7), 6-2 victory over Czech world number 30 Jiri Lehecka in the final of the Wimbledon warm-up event last Sunday (22). The 22-year-old has extended his career-best winning streak to 18 matches, putting him in the perfect position to defend his Wimbledon title.

ECB and BCCI join hands to oppose Saudi T20 league: Report

THE PROPOSED Saudi T20 league, reportedly a USD 400 million venture, will not receive support from the Board of Control for Cricket in India (BCCI) or the England and Wales Cricket Board (ECB), according to a news report.

The news report, by The Guardian, stated that both boards are working together to safeguard their own leagues from being impacted.
